He died as the result of burns sustained in a fire during a 15-day low-pressure endurance experiment in Moscow. The government concealed the death, along with Bondarenko's membership in the cosmonaut corps, until 1980. A crater on the Moon's far side is named after him.","profile_image":"https://thespacedevs-dev.nyc3.digitaloceanspaces.com/media/images/valentin2520bondarenko_image_20181128223624.jpg","profile_image_thumbnail":"https://thespacedevs-dev.nyc3.digitaloceanspaces.com/media/images/255bauto255d__image_thumbnail_20240305190922.jpeg","wiki":"https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Valentin_Bondarenko","flights":[],"landings":[],"flights_count":0,"landings_count":0,"spacewalks_count":0,"last_flight":null,"first_flight":null,"spacewalks":[]}
